Charity---the need of the hour

By: Sanjeev Jha

If we look globally then one can find the near destitute condition in which the children in the third world countries are living in. Usually poor children can be seen working, cleaning utensils, peddling small goodies or simply begging to make a living. Sometimes they also take some other anti-social steps like stealing which can later on become later on become big crimes.

Witnessing such situation makes us question: after all we have been reading in the papers where it's reported that we are making fast progress, human race is progressing in such a way that has never been imagined. If such is the case, then why its future (children are the future of our race) have to live a life of slave without proper food, proper education or any basic facility. Are all those reports about development of our nation is false then? It seems that the development that is happening is not all-round. The entire social structure is not benefiting from it. The profits of the development remains confined to specific social pockets. The poor remains poor and his condition is getting worse, whereas the rich is getting richer. That seems to be the case.

One way to see that the problem of the poor is alleviated is through charity. Protect them for sometime and enable them to take care of their problems in the future. This can be done through the charity that is made by those who have got everything with the grace of God.

If one has to think about the future, the children coming from poor families who cannot afford to go to school and instead are working or loitering around, needs to be placed back in school. This can be done through establishing schools built from the donations made by people who do have a decent living. These schools must provide free education and all the facilities to support their education. Education would empower them to take decisions for themselves and have control over their own life.

Charity is the need of the hour, if one wants to help the poor.
